A tropical disturbance laden with heavy rainfall and high moisture levels is forecast to move into the southern regions within the next few days, raising concerns of flooding. Authorities have issued preliminary warnings, but the precise path and severity remain uncertain.

Meteorological agencies have identified a tropical disturbance over the Gulf of Mexico that is gaining moisture and organization. Satellite images show increased cloud cover and rainfall activity, with forecasts indicating it could intensify further as it approaches land. Local officials in southern states have issued flood watches and urged residents to prepare for possible flooding, especially in low-lying and urban areas. The disturbance’s development is still ongoing, and its exact trajectory, strength, and timing are subject to change based on environmental conditions. No official declaration of a tropical storm has been made yet, but the potential for heavy rainfall and flooding is significant if the system intensifies.

Experts from meteorological agencies emphasize that the situation remains fluid, and forecasts could shift as new data becomes available. Emergency services are on alert, and residents are advised to stay informed through official channels. The disturbance’s waterlogged nature increases the likelihood of flash floods and river rises in vulnerable communities.

Recent Tropical Activity and Regional Climate Conditions

The Gulf of Mexico and southern coastal areas are currently experiencing high humidity and warm sea surface temperatures, conditions conducive to tropical development. This disturbance follows a relatively quiet start to the hurricane season but highlights ongoing risks of tropical systems forming in the region. Historically, similar disturbances have caused significant flooding in southern states, especially when slow-moving or interacting with existing weather patterns. Meteorologists have been tracking this system since it was first identified earlier this week, and its potential to develop further remains under close observation.

“The system is currently waterlogged and showing signs of organization, but its future intensity and path remain uncertain. Residents should stay alert and follow official advisories.”

— a meteorological agency spokesperson
